
Michigan Student Taken at Gunpoint From Bus Stop
If you’ve got kids who take the bus, this is the kind of story that stops you in your tracks.
A student in Michigan was taken at gunpoint while waiting for the bus Monday morning in Hamtramck, and yeah…that’s about as scary as it sounds.
Where Did the Hamtramck Bus Stop Abduction Happen?
According to Fox 2 Detroit, the incident happened around 7 a.m. near Edwin and Pulaski while the student was standing at the bus stop.
At some point, a suspect pulled up, showed a gun, and forced the student into a vehicle.
Several other students actually witnessed the whole thing.
How Did Classmates Help Police Track the Suspect?
Here’s the part that almost sounds like something out of a movie.
Classmates immediately jumped into action, using cell phone data and social media to help track the student’s location. That information was passed along to the police right away.
Officers were able to locate the vehicle, make a stop, and take the suspect into custody.
Was the Hamtramck Student Found Safe?
Thankfully, this didn’t end the way it could have.
Police say the student was recovered safely and there’s no ongoing threat.
Who Abducted the Student in Hamtramck?
Right now, police haven’t released much about the suspect. There’s no name, no detailed description, or anything at this point.
